ufd_enable False NA Enabled, or Disabled Add or Remove the
uplink to the Uplink
Failure Detection (UFD)
group. The UFD group
identifies the loss of
connectivity to the
upstream switch and
notifies the servers
that are connected
to the switch. During
an uplink failure,
the switch disables
the corresponding
downstream server
ports. The downstream
servers can then select
alternate connectivity
routes, if available.
